Output 1f658077bf34c7412a6b53b8dd1ae877941dc49af81e8c6d852e755d43ac7f5f:7

value
106906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588f6e090d603b3c5d068e08887dbadf4bde2384 OP_EQUAL
address
39mHD6yXECz7H9ndrvbvWvpyB1UU4eR1L6
transaction
1f658077bf34c7412a6b53b8dd1ae877941dc49af81e8c6d852e755d43ac7f5f
spent
true